What Types of Work and Facilities Can Emergency Room RNs Expect in Keyser, WV?

As a Registered Nurse specializing in Emergency Room services in Keyser, West Virginia, you will play a crucial role in delivering high-quality, emergency care in a variety of healthcare settings, including local hospitals, urgent care centers, and community health clinics. In these fast-paced environments, you can expect to triage patients, perform critical assessments, administer medications, and collaborate with multidisciplinary teams to ensure timely interventions for a diverse patient population, from trauma cases to acute illnesses. Keyser’s healthcare facilities, equipped with state-of-the-art technology, provide an opportunity to hone your clinical skills while contributing to the well-being of the community. Additionally, you’ll engage in patient education and discharge planning, ensuring that individuals and families receive continued care and support after their emergency visits.

The Penn State Health Milton S. Hershey Medical Center (MSHMC) is a 548-bed[7] non-profit, research and academic medical center located in Hershey, Pennsylvania, providing tertiary and healthcare needs for the Central Pennsylvania and the capitol region. MSHMC the region’s only academic university-level teaching center. The hospital is owned by the Pennsylvania State University Health System and the second largest hospital in the system. JSUMC is affiliated with the Penn State College of Medicine. MSHMC is also a desinated level I trauma center and has a helipad to handle medevac patients.
